The Importance Of Dealing With Tooth Loss

Tooth loss has more than just a cosmetic impact on a person’s life. In addition to hurting your ability to feel confident when you smile, that loss can make it harder for you to bite and chew naturally. The uneven movements you rely on can cause discomfort and raise your risk for TMJ disorder. They can also cause you to overuse certain teeth and wear them down prematurely.

Placing A Custom Dental Bridge

A dental bridge is a restoration that depends on a pair of crowns for permanent support. Those crowns are placed on the teeth that surround the empty space in your upper or lower row of teeth. Once set in place, they offer stability to permanently keep the bridge in position even as you rely on it to bite and chew through the years.

Detailed measurements are used to craft a restoration that will fit securely and look natural. Because this work combines functional and cosmetic benefits, you can be eager to have work done so that you can bite and chew, smile, and speak with renewed confidence!
